The backlighting on my instrument cluster is dim behind the 10mph area and bright everywhere else. There is a light bulb or LED burned out. On most cars you can just replace a bulb back there. Is this possible on the GX470?
I can not find the part number anywhere.

I have the same issue and the dealer told me you have to replace the whole instrument panel to the tune of about $900 (if i remember correctly). I have just gotten used to it.
